Mauro Icardi set to sign a new deal and end Real Madrid’s transfer plans

The Inter Milan frontman has been permanently linked with a move to replace Karim Benzema for quite some time and it looks like Icardi might end things with a new deal.

Mauro Icardi has been linked with the best of Europe, especially with him performing season after season for Inter Milan as their captain. The Argentine is one of the most sought-after strikers in world football ever since his breakout 14/15 season, although many argue that it was his 13/14 that got him noticed. Icardi scored 22 goals in 36 appearances in 2014/15 Serie A and has since then go on to become the Nerazzurri numero uno striker.

However, with Real Madrid, Chelsea, Manchester United, Bayern Munich, PSG and so many others after his signature, Inter Milan have had issues over the last few months. The Serie A side and the Argentine have been in contract negotiations with Icardi’s wife and agent Wanda still dealing with the club, but the Argentine star is unhappy with the salary that Inter is reportedly offering.

According to reports, the Serie A club plan to increase the clause as well as extending Icardi’s current deal to 2023 and even give him a salary worth around 7 million-per-year. And if reports and rumours are to be believed then things are coming to an end soon, especially if his agent/wife Wanda Nara’s comments are to be believed.

Icardi’s wife has revealed that negotiations are getting close with  a simple and yet elegant tweet which went on to say “It is 00:30 and I’m still here to read the pages of the renewal.” In less than Twitter’s limited word count and a simple tag to connect the 26-year-old to the tweet showed that Real Madrid and all the transfer rumours linking the 160 goal striker might just be coming to an end.

He has been in great form this season, so it’s no surprise why the likes of Real Madrid, Chelsea, Manchester United and even Barcelona (despite the conflict between him and Messi). With 12 goals this season, four of them alone in the Champions League while Real Madrid lost humiliatingly 3-0 to CSKA Moscow.
